Senior Buyer overview:

We invite you to embark on an exciting 12-month journey with them as a vital member of the Strategic Sourcing team. Reporting to the Strategic Sourcing Manager, you will play a pivotal role in shaping and executing the global supply chain strategy for assigned commodities.

Senior Buyer responsibilities:

Lead the development and execution of a global supply chain strategy for assigned commodities, aligning with Company's goals for cost reduction, supplier on-time delivery, lead-times, quality, and inventory reduction.
Collaborate to rationalise the supply base, drive sourcing from low-cost suppliers, and leverage indirect material and services spend across their business units.
Negotiate and implement Long-Term Supplier Agreements, obtaining competitive bids, analysing costs, and ensuring contracts align with total cost considerations, quality standards, and delivery capabilities.
Continuously monitor and enhance supplier performance, supporting functions and business units to address supplier-related challenges.
Lead periodic Business Reviews with key suppliers to enhance quality, delivery, cost, and service performance while fostering strategic alignment.
